“Slave Wages?” Mzansi Fumes as Mihlali Ndamase Accused of Exploitation and Unlawful Firing – Look

The timeline is burning, and this time, it’s not because of a glamorous makeup tutorial. Beauty mogul and “Soft Life” ambassador Mihlali Ndamase is closing off 2025 in the middle of a PR nightmare, facing severe backlash over allegations of labor exploitation and unlawful termination.

Just weeks after the high-profile, glitzy launch of her new boutique, Treasury, reports have surfaced suggesting that the business is already crumbling under the weight of poor sales and low foot traffic. But it is the alleged treatment of her staff that has sent shockwaves through social media.

In a move described by critics as “desperate,” Ndamase allegedly abruptly fired the boutique’s only employee. However, the controversy reached a boiling point when the staff member’s alleged salary details were leaked online.

The numbers have sparked a furious debate about the dark side of influencer culture. Mzansi was quick to point out the jarring contrast between Ndamase’s brand—built on luxury travel, designer bags, and opulence—and the “peanuts” she was reportedly paying the person running her business.

“How can you preach ‘Black Excellence’ and ‘Soft Life’ while paying your staff starvation wages?” one user raged on X (formerly Twitter), a sentiment echoed by thousands.

For many South Africans struggling with unemployment and the rising cost of living, the allegations of exploitation struck a raw nerve. The incident has quickly shifted from a business failure to a moral indictment, with fans demanding accountability.
